我们有一个使用.net技术的web和控制台应用程序。控制台应用程序将通过web应用程序运行,传递用于分析和报告目的所需的参数。控制台工具将被实用地执行,然后该工具将独立运行以生成用于分析和报告的数据。
现在,我们正在尝试将技术从.NET改为MEAN stack。我们已经开发了web应用程序。MEAN stack中有没有像控制台应用一样的技术/服务?这样我就可以单独执行该工具/服务,为.NET之类的报告生成数据。
如果没有技术,请建议我如何在均值堆栈中实现这一点?
发布于 2017-05-12 07:18:09
MEAN堆栈包括Node.js,它可用于创建命令行应用程序。
您可以使用process.argv在Node.js JavaScript文件中获取命令行参数
process.argv是一个包含命令行参数的数组。第一个元素将是‘JavaScript’,第二个元素将是节点文件的名称。接下来的元素将是任何额外的命令行参数。
然后,可以通过运行node file.js argument1 argument2来执行该文件。
https://stackoverflow.com/questions/43918486
复制相似问题